    Hi, Lori. I had a very skilled PS perform a DIEP after my exchange failed. I even worked through the academic year until I could get grades in before getting it done. I just finished Stage 2 and am very pleased w/the results (I have a postop next week). It's important to be sure that you get an experienced PS--I'm sure you can get referrals from the list. The surgery isn't a walk in the park, but I told my PS 4 days postop (I was in the hospital for 7) that I felt like myself for the first time since my mx.
